MINISTER TO CANADA.
Received December 15, 9.35 a.m
AVASHINGTON, Dec. 15. President Hoover has appointed Colonel Nathan AVilliam AlacChesney, of Illinois, to be the United States Minister to Canada, succeeding Air Hanford MacNider, who has resigned. Colonel AlacChesney, who is 54 years of age, was formerly a Chicago Judge.
